Donald Routt's Obituary
Donald Routt, age 79, passed away Monday, October 8, 2018 following a long illness. He was born in Muskegon on February 2, 1939. Don was employed by Pepsi Co. and RC Cola for over 20 years. Don was also the owner-operator of Triangle Market, Artistic Sign and Neon Design Studio, and Vinyl Graphics. On October 28, 1977, he married the former Sandra Burns and she survives him along with 8 children: Connie (Greg) Hull, Byron (Dawn) Routt, Dean Routt, Max Squazzino, Deborah (Paul) Priest, Jason (Cari) Tester, Donielle Routt, and Brandon (Jana) Routt; 14 grandchildren: Travis, Ashley, Nicki, Paul, Brianna, Connor, Elizabeth, Sam, Graham, Edyn, Leo, Abbie, Cassie and Lauren; 5 great-grandchildren: Braidy, Mazyn, Aidyn, Owen, and Jerzey; 1 sister, Karen (John) Hellman; and 1 brother-in-law, Jack Garlock. He was preceded in death by his parents, Arthur and Lulu Routt; his twin brother, Ronald Routt; and his sister, Barbara.
